A week ahead before mixing this, a good amount of finely chopped (but uncooked) rhubarbs are added to a bottle of gin. Let it sit for 5-7 days, and move it around a bit daily. The gin picks up a surprisingly large amount of flavour from the rhubarbs, and on top of that also a lot of gorgeous pink colour. Violette liqueur is a very special ingredient. It has an intensely blue colour as well as a really potent flavour. It can easily owerpower any cocktail. However used in the right amounts (read: small amounts) it can be pretty fantastic. It has floral, almost perfumed notes and it contributes with both an exotic and a decadent vibe.⁠ ⁠ In this recipe the violet liqueur is combined with gin and lemon juice, making it very similar to classic cocktail Aviation.
